镜像查重字典的确定、镜像文件存储方法及装置

    公开(公告)号:CN115344532A

    公开(公告)日:2022-11-15

    申请号:CN202210993824.8

    申请日:2022-08-18

    Inventor: 黄靖 彭涛 马介悦

    Abstract: 本说明书实施例提供一种镜像查重字典的确定方法及装置,基于镜像按照数据块和数据块信息分开存储的格式进行存储,利用元数据中的数据块信息构建查重字典。一方面,利用数据块信息对镜像进行聚类,从而按类别挖掘出类别查重集,另一方面,在排除类别查重集所对应的数据块信息后,对单个镜像还基于历史版本中的数据块信息预测未来可能复用的数据块,将相应的数据块信息构成预测查重集。进一步地,由类别查重集和预测查重集构成镜像的查重字典,从而在镜像更新时,将待存储数据按照数据块和元数据格式处理后,利用数据块信息与镜像的查重字典进行比较。该方式可以基于预测构建查重字典,避免复用的数据块的冗余存储,提高镜像存储、使用效率。

    用户态文件系统热升级方法、装置、服务器及介质

    公开(公告)号:CN111552489B

    公开(公告)日:2022-04-26

    申请号:CN202010247450.6

    申请日:2020-03-31

    Abstract: 本说明书实施例提供了一种用户态文件系统热升级方法、装置、服务器及介质,通过在运行目标用户态文件系统前,将目标用户态文件系统进程与内核态FUSE驱动之间通信通道的文件描述符克隆到预先创建的管理进程中,在该管理进程中备份与内核态FUSE驱动之间的备用通信通道,然后在目标用户态文件系统进程运行过程中,若监测到升级指令,则将备用通信通道的文件描述符克隆到新启动的用户态文件系统进程中,使得新启动的用户态文件系统进程拥有与内核态FUSE驱动的新通信通道,进而就可以运行新启动的用户态文件系统进程,实现用户态文件系统的热升级。

    用户态文件系统热升级方法、装置、服务器及介质

    公开(公告)号:CN111552489A

    公开(公告)日:2020-08-18

    申请号:CN202010247450.6

    申请日:2020-03-31

    Abstract: 本说明书实施例提供了一种用户态文件系统热升级方法、装置、服务器及介质,通过在运行目标用户态文件系统前,将目标用户态文件系统进程与内核态FUSE驱动之间通信通道的文件描述符克隆到预先创建的管理进程中,在该管理进程中备份与内核态FUSE驱动之间的备用通信通道,然后在目标用户态文件系统进程运行过程中,若监测到升级指令,则将备用通信通道的文件描述符克隆到新启动的用户态文件系统进程中,使得新启动的用户态文件系统进程拥有与内核态FUSE驱动的新通信通道,进而就可以运行新启动的用户态文件系统进程,实现用户态文件系统的热升级。

    一种在虚拟机中执行指令的方法和一种虚拟机监视器

    公开(公告)号:CN116225765A

    公开(公告)日:2023-06-06

    申请号:CN202310227996.9

    申请日:2023-03-06

    Abstract: 说明书实施例提供了一种在虚拟机中执行指令的方法,该方法包括:截获运行于宿主机用户态的虚拟机内核、或虚拟机中的第一用户进程执行第一指令触发的第一异常,并将第一异常发送到运行于宿主机内核态的虚拟机监视器;虚拟机监视器根据第一异常的触发源,处理第一异常,其中,若第一指令的执行者为虚拟机内核,虚拟机监视器从第一异常的异常信息中,获取第一指令的执行上下文;以及,根据第一指令的执行上下文,模拟第一指令的执行,得到第一执行结果,并将第一执行结果发送给虚拟机内核。

Patent Agency Ranking